Galvanising offers corrosion protection for up to 20 years and can be used as a finish, which is grey in colour, or the grey base coat can additionally be spray painted or powder coated.
The two most common types of powder coating are nylon and polyester. Nylon powder coating is glossy and tough with outstanding adhesion and superb resistance to solvents and oils. Polyester powder coating is a hard, abrasion-resistant coating based on polyester resin that is cured at a high temperature, providing a superior smooth surface that is resistant to colour fade in direct sunlight.
This finish is applied in our own spray and blast facilities, where the steelwork is blast cleaned and primed. A layer of undercoat is followed by two finishing coats to give a superior quality finish.
Polishing is a finishing process applied to stainless steel, whose finished options include brushed, polished and mirror.
Plastic handrails provide a warm-to-the-touch finish and is fully compliant with the Disability Discrimination Act, Building Regulations Part M.
Wood capping provides a natural, warm-to-the-touch finish and is fully compliant with the Disability Discrimination Act, Building Regulations Part M.
The best finishes start with shotblasting to remove rust, scale and provide the perfect key for the protective treatments of our products.
Micaceous Iron Oxide (MIO), with rust inhibitive prigments, gives a high build coating for the protection of all steel.
